(WKBW release) Buffalo police are investigating two burglary incidents where the electrical power was cut to the businesses.
According to a news release:
Police say that sometime between Tuesday night and Wednesday morning, suspect or suspects cut the power and smashed a front store window with a brick to the Radio Shack located in the 300 block of Amherst Street.
It appears the suspect or suspects made off with different types of electronics including laptops and X Box systems.
Northwest district detectives are also investigating an attempted burglary at a store in the 100 block of Colvin.
Detectives say suspects again smashed a glass door to the business and cut the power lines. It does not appear that anything was taken. The incident occurred
just after 2 a.m. Wednesday morning.
